Site Prep Procedures

Thorough site preparation is critical for a successful concrete installation process. First, the area must be cleared of debris, vegetation, and any existing structures. This step guarantees a clean, stable foundation. Following this, the soil is examined for compaction and drainage capabilities; if necessary, it may be compacted or treated to improve stability. Next, proper grading is performed to establish a level surface and facilitate water runoff. Installing forms is also essential, as they define the shape and dimensions of the concrete pour. Finally, reinforcing materials, such as rebar or wire mesh, are positioned to enhance the concrete's strength. Proper execution of these steps lays the groundwork for a long-lasting and reliable concrete structure.

Why the Curing Process Matters

Though commonly neglected, the curing process fulfills a critical purpose in the success of a concrete installation. This phase initiates promptly once the concrete is poured and entails keeping adequate moisture, temperature, and time to enable the concrete to reach its intended strength and durability. Proper curing stops complications including cracking, surface scaling, and weaknesses in the material. Techniques may include applying to the surface wet burlap, applying curing compounds, or applying plastic sheeting to maintain moisture levels. Typically, the curing period extends from a few days to several weeks, according to environmental conditions and the specific concrete mix used. Understanding the significance of this process assures that the final structure remains sturdy and enduring, meeting the expectations of clients.

Standard Cleaning Procedures

Regular maintenance routines are necessary for sustaining the lifespan and look of concrete surfaces. Consistent care, for instance removing debris and dirt, assists in avoiding staining and deterioration. Power washing can effectively remove persistent stains, algae, or moss that may gather over time. It is recommended to use a mild detergent during this process to stop chemical damage. Moreover, promptly dealing with source spills, especially from oil or chemicals, can prevent permanent discoloration. In colder climates, eliminating snow and ice is crucial to inhibit cracking due to ice expansion. Consistent evaluations for cracks or surface wear can also support identifying issues early, making certain that concrete surfaces remain durable and visually appealing for years to come.

Sealant Application Frequency

Usually, putting on a sealant to concrete surfaces every one to three years is essential for upholding their integrity and appearance. This frequency varies with factors including weather conditions, foot traffic, and the type of sealant used. Routine inspections can help determine when reapplication is essential; symptoms like discoloration, wear, or water penetration demonstrate that the sealant has worn away. Homeowners should opt for high-quality sealants designed for their specific concrete applications, ensuring better durability. Additionally, proper surface preparation before application increases adhesion and effectiveness. By following this maintenance schedule, property owners can safeguard their concrete investments, prolonging the lifespan of surfaces and reducing costly repairs in the future.

Future Trends and Innovations in Modern Concrete Solutions

How is the concrete industry evolving to meet the demands of a rapidly changing world? Advancements in concrete technology are forming a more sustainable and resilient future. Researchers are developing eco-friendly alternatives, such as recycled aggregates and bio-based additives, which reduce the carbon footprint of concrete production. Additionally, advancements in smart concrete—incorporating sensors that monitor structural health—enable proactive maintenance, enhancing safety and durability.

Another emerging trend is the utilization of 3D printing tech, allowing for rapid construction of complex structures with minimal waste. Additionally, self-healing concrete, which employs bacteria or other materials to repair cracks autonomously, is building attention, offering extended-life infrastructures.

With growing urbanization and climate change affecting construction methods, these advancements showcase the industry's devotion to sustainability and efficiency. The future of concrete technology offers significant promise for transforming how society builds, guaranteeing structures that are durable as well as environmentally conscious.

How Long Does It Generally Take for Concrete to Fully Cure?

Concrete generally requires approximately 28 days to achieve complete curing, though the initial set happens within several hours. Variables like temperature, humidity, and mix design can affect the curing process and overall strength development.

What Kinds of Concrete Finishes Can You Choose From?

Various concrete finishes feature polished, stamped, exposed aggregate, brushed, and troweled. Every finish delivers unique aesthetics and textures, addressing different design preferences and functional requirements in home and business applications.

Can You Pour Concrete During Cold Weather?

Certainly, concrete can be poured in cold weather, but specific precautions are essential. Correct techniques and materials, such as heated water and insulating blankets, help make certain the concrete cures properly despite lower temperatures.

What Action Should I Take When My Concrete Cracks?

When cracks form in concrete, evaluate the scope of the damage. Small fissures can be filled with a concrete patching compound, while larger cracks will require professional evaluation and repair to maintain structural integrity and prevent more deterioration.

How Can I Determine if My Concrete Needs Resurfacing?

To determine if concrete necessitates resurfacing, homeowners should look for obvious cracks, uneven surfaces, or discoloration. In addition, pooling water or a rough texture may indicate that resurfacing is needed for better aesthetics and functionality.
